Output 856e8863aaa02fea37379a0e91f04d52cffc8c034065d01298d7d1a409079f08:0

value
1125552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81587b064199ece62f59b94c80e0e136a722da6 OP_EQUAL
address
3MPZfurtpu6FkXoErEE6TR3jmCXA1XXwd8
transaction
856e8863aaa02fea37379a0e91f04d52cffc8c034065d01298d7d1a409079f08